Common Name | 2-Fluoro-2',3'-dideoxyadenosine |
---|
Description | [5-(6-amino-2-fluoro-9H-purin-9-yl)oxolan-2-yl]methanol belongs to the class of organic compounds known as purine 2',3'-dideoxyribonucleosides. Purine 2',3'-dideoxyribonucleosides are compounds consisting of a purine linked to a ribose which lacks a hydroxyl group at positions 2 and 3. Based on a literature review very few articles have been published on [5-(6-amino-2-fluoro-9H-purin-9-yl)oxolan-2-yl]methanol. This compound has been identified in human blood as reported by (PMID: 31557052 ). 2-fluoro-2',3'-dideoxyadenosine is not a naturally occurring metabolite and is only found in those individuals exposed to this compound or its derivatives. Technically 2-Fluoro-2',3'-dideoxyadenosine is part of the human exposome. The exposome can be defined as the collection of all the exposures of an individual in a lifetime and how those exposures relate to health. An individual's exposure begins before birth and includes insults from environmental and occupational sources. |
